在当今的互联网环境中,网站安全是用户信任的基石。当您访问一个网站时,浏览器地址栏中显示的挂锁图标和“https://”前缀,就是SSL证书在默默工作的标志。它不仅是网站安全的守护者,更是现代网络通信不可或缺的标准配置。
SSL证书是什么
SSL证书,全称为安全套接层证书,现已发展为其继任者TLS证书。它是一种数字证书,通过在客户端(如浏览器)和服务器(如网站)之间建立一条加密的、安全的连接,来确保两者之间传输的数据不被窃取或篡改。
核心工作原理:加密与身份验证
SSL证书的核心功能可以概括为两点:加密传输和身份验证。当用户访问一个部署了SSL证书的网站时,会触发一个名为“SSL/TLS握手”的过程。在这个过程中,服务器会向浏览器出示其SSL证书。浏览器会验证该证书是否由受信任的证书颁发机构签发、是否在有效期内、以及证书中的域名是否与正在访问的网站域名一致。
推荐阅读 SSL证书是什么?作用、类型与申请安装全指南。
验证通过后,双方会协商生成一对唯一的“会话密钥”,用于加密和解密后续所有的通信数据。这意味着,即使数据在传输过程中被截获,攻击者看到的也只是一堆无法解读的乱码。
证书的关键组成部分
一个标准的SSL证书包含几个关键信息:证书持有者的域名、证书持有者的组织信息、签发证书的证书颁发机构、以及证书的有效期。这些信息被一个由CA机构生成的数字签名所保护,确保了证书本身的真实性和不可伪造性。
为什么SSL证书至关重要
部署SSL证书已从一项“加分项”变为一项“必选项”,其重要性体现在多个层面。
保障数据安全与隐私
这是SSL证书最根本的作用。它保护了网站与访客之间交换的所有敏感信息,例如登录凭证、信用卡号、个人身份信息、聊天记录等。对于电商、银行、医疗或任何涉及用户隐私的网站,没有SSL证书就如同在公共场所大声朗读用户的密码。
建立用户信任与品牌信誉
浏览器会明确告知用户网站的安全状态。一个带有绿色挂锁和“安全”标识的网站,能显著提升用户的信任感和安全感,从而降低跳出率,提高转化率。反之,浏览器会对未使用HTTPS的网站标记为“不安全”,这会让大部分用户望而却步,严重损害品牌形象。
推荐阅读 SSL证书详解:类型、作用与免费申请全指南,保障网站安全。
提升搜索引擎排名
谷歌等主流搜索引擎早已将HTTPS作为搜索排名的一个积极信号。使用SSL证书的网站在搜索结果中通常会获得比同等条件下的HTTP网站更高的排名。这意味着,部署SSL证书不仅是为了安全,也是一项重要的搜索引擎优化策略。
满足合规性要求
许多行业法规和标准,如支付卡行业数据安全标准、欧盟的《通用数据保护条例》等,都明确要求对传输中的敏感数据进行加密。使用SSL证书是满足这些合规性要求最基本、最关键的一步。
如何选择适合的SSL证书
面对市场上种类繁多的SSL证书,根据网站的需求和规模进行选择至关重要。主要可以从验证级别和覆盖域名两个维度来考量。
根据验证级别选择
域名验证证书:这是最基本的类型,证书颁发机构仅验证申请者对域名的控制权(例如通过邮件或DNS记录)。签发速度快,成本低,适合个人网站、博客或测试环境。
组织验证证书:在DV验证的基础上,CA还会核实申请组织的真实存在性(如公司名称、地址等)。证书中会显示组织信息,比DV证书更能彰显可信度,适合企业官网。
扩展验证证书:这是验证最严格、信任等级最高的证书。CA会进行严格的线下组织审查。浏览器地址栏会直接显示绿色的公司名称,是金融、电商等高端网站的标配,能最大程度提升用户信任。
推荐阅读 SSL证书究竟是什么?从原理到选购安装的完整指南。
根据覆盖域名选择
单域名证书:只保护一个具体的域名。
多域名证书:一张证书可以保护多个完全不同的域名,管理起来更加方便。
通配符证书:可以保护一个主域名及其所有同级子域名。例如,一张用于 *.yourdomain.com 的证书可以保护 blog.yourdomain.com、shop.yourdomain.com 等。
如何申请与部署SSL证书
申请和部署SSL证书的流程已经非常标准化,主要分为以下步骤。
第一步:生成证书签名请求
在您的网站服务器上,需要生成一个CSR文件。这个过程会同时创建一对密钥:私钥和公钥。私钥必须被严格保密并存储在服务器上,而CSR文件中包含了您的公钥和申请信息(如域名、组织等)。这是您向CA“申请”证书的正式文件。
第二步:向CA提交申请并完成验证
在您选择的证书服务商处购买所需的SSL证书产品,然后将生成的CSR文件提交。接下来,您需要根据所选的验证类型完成验证流程。对于DV证书,通常只需通过邮件点击确认链接或设置一条DNS解析记录即可,过程自动化程度高,最快几分钟即可签发。
第三步:安装与部署证书
CA验证通过后,会将签发的SSL证书文件发送给您。您需要将证书文件连同中间证书链一起,安装到您的Web服务器上。具体的安装步骤因服务器类型而异。安装完成后,务必将网站的所有HTTP流量重定向到HTTPS,确保用户始终通过安全连接访问。
第四步:定期续费与管理
SSL证书有有效期,通常为一年。必须在证书过期前完成续费和新证书的替换,否则网站将出现安全警告,导致服务中断。建议设置提醒,或考虑使用支持自动续期的证书服务。
总结
SSL证书是现代网站安全的基石,它通过加密连接和身份验证,保护数据、建立信任、提升搜索排名并满足合规要求。选择证书时,应根据网站性质考虑验证级别,并根据域名结构决定是使用单域名、多域名还是通配符证书。申请流程已高度简化,从生成CSR、完成验证到安装部署,都有清晰的路径可循。为您的网站部署SSL证书,是一项投入小、回报高的必要安全投资。
FAQ 常见问题
免费的SSL证书和付费的有什么区别?
免费证书通常指Let‘s Encrypt等机构颁发的DV证书,其加密强度与付费DV证书相同,能实现基础的HTTPS加密。主要区别在于:免费证书有效期短,需频繁续签;缺乏技术支持;不提供商业担保;无法申请OV或EV等高级验证类型。付费证书提供更长的有效期、专业的技术支持、价值不等的赔付保障,并能通过OV/EV验证展示企业身份,更适合商业网站。
部署SSL证书会影响网站速度吗?
在建立连接的初始“握手”阶段,由于需要进行加密算法协商和证书验证,会引入极小的延迟。但一旦安全连接建立,现代的加密和解密过程对服务器和客户端造成的性能开销微乎其微,几乎可以忽略不计。相反,由于HTTP/2协议通常要求基于HTTPS,部署SSL后启用HTTP/2反而可能大幅提升网站的加载速度。
一个SSL证书可以用于多个服务器吗?
可以,但需要注意私钥的安全。同一张证书可以安装在多台服务器上(如用于负载均衡)。关键在于,您必须将相同的证书文件和私钥部署到每一台需要提供该HTTPS服务的服务器上。务必确保私钥在分发的过程中保持安全,防止泄露。
如果SSL证书过期了会怎样?
浏览器和操作系统会严格检查证书的有效期。一旦证书过期,访客在访问网站时会看到醒目的“不安全”警告,提示连接非私密,并可能阻止用户继续访问。这会直接导致用户流失、信任丧失和业务中断。因此,提前设置提醒或使用自动续期功能至关重要。
如何判断一个网站使用的SSL证书是否可靠?
您可以点击浏览器地址栏的挂锁图标,查看证书详情。可靠的证书应显示:由知名受信任的CA签发、证书中的域名与访问的网站一致、证书在有效期内、以及对于EV证书,能显示已验证的单位名称。如果挂锁图标显示为红色、有斜线或出现警告提示,则说明证书存在问题,应谨慎对待。
下一步,接下来该怎么做?
延伸阅读与实用知识
下面这些内容与本文主题相关,适合继续深入阅读。优先从与你当前问题最接近的文章开始看,再逐步扩展到周边主题,效果通常会更好。